Why Satoru Gojo Captivates the Internet

Satoru Gojo looking confident with his blindfold down

The popularity of Gojo stems from more than just his combat abilities. His character design is a masterclass in visual storytelling. By keeping his eyes hidden for the majority of the series, MAPPA and Gege Akutami created an air of intrigue that makes every reveal of his “Six Eyes” a monumental event. When fans look for Gojo pics, they are often looking for these specific moments of vulnerability or peak intensity. His aesthetic—a mix of sleek black high-collar uniforms and that iconic hair—makes him an incredibly versatile subject for fan artists and photographers alike.

Beyond his physical appearance, his personality is a paradox. He can be childish and irritating one moment, and then cold and calculated the next. This range is exactly why social media platforms are flooded with content featuring him. If you are curating a collection, you will likely notice that the most popular images fall into these categories:

  • Battle-ready poses: Featuring his Domain Expansion: Unlimited Void.
  • Casual attire: Showcasing him in his more relaxed, "off-duty" state.
  • The "Six Eyes" reveal: High-definition shots focusing on his piercing blue eyes.
  • Student-era snapshots: Images showing his younger self from the Hidden Inventory arc.

Maintaining Quality in Your Digital Archive

As you collect your favorite Gojo pics, keep in mind that maintaining the integrity of the file is important. Frequent re-sharing on platforms like WhatsApp or certain social media apps can lead to compression, which reduces the clarity of the image. To keep your archives pristine, try to save the original files in a cloud-based storage service or a dedicated folder on your device. This prevents the “blurred” effect that occurs over time with repeated file transfers.

It is also helpful to organize your folders by specific narrative arcs. For example, keeping "Hidden Inventory" images separate from "Shibuya Incident" images allows you to navigate your collection much faster. Not only does this save time, but it also allows you to enjoy the evolution of the character's design throughout the series, from his younger, more arrogant school days to the seasoned, heavy-shouldered teacher he becomes.
